WebWrite a Photography Business Plan. Photo by Portra via iStock. One of the first and most important tasks before you is to write a business plan. While it's great to realize that you want to be a photographer, simply knowing it is not enough. You need to outline your goals, your plans, your finances, and other details in your business plan. WebAug 14, 2024 · Home Photography Studio Tip #2: Design Your “Set” Once you’ve figured out an area with good lighting, you’ll need to designate a certain amount of small space for your “set”. A blank wall could be handy here, but if you don’t have one, don’t worry. You can also use a kitchen/bathroom counter, a stool in the middle of a room, etc.

Your shutter … flixton sports and social clubWebSep 15, 2024 · Portrait photography captures a person’s essence, personality, identity, and attitude utilizing backgrounds, lighting, and posing. To start portrait photography, hone your skills and acquire a professional camera and photo editing software.
